qubitsok.com

Cut Noise. Work Quantum.

Back to Job Listings

United States

Posted 138 days ago

Software DevOps Build and Release Engineer

🏢 QuEra

AI Summarised
Visit Website

Role Type

🛠️ Engineer / Developer

Role Focus

💻 Code Systems

Seniority

🌿 Experienced
🌳 Senior / Lead

Employer Type

🏢 Industry

This role involves leading the planning, integration, and maintenance of software build processes for quantum computers. The engineer will use expertise in Software Engineering, DevOps, and CI/CD workflows to deliver complex control hardware and software, ensuring reliable and scalable quantum operations. They will collaborate with software and hardware engineers to build systems for QuEra ’s quantum computers.

Key Responsibilities

Implement, test, and maintain software build and installation systems to produce software artifacts for QuEra ’s quantum computers.

Evaluate and recommend hardware platforms to expand the software build environments.

Aid in designing a scalable architecture that supports modular expansion, system health monitoring, build artifact storage, and distribution.

Collaborate with cross-functional teams to align system-level decisions with calibration workflows, compilers, and experimental software.

Required Skills

Bachelor's or master's degree in software engineering, Computer Engineering, Computer science, or a related field.

5+ years of experience with software engineering build and release processes, including complex branching strategies and CI/CD workflows using source control systems.

Experience implementing configuration management, diagnostics, and system monitoring for CI/CD systems.

Experience implementing, expanding, and maintaining release engineering frameworks like Jenkins, Tekton, Github Actions, or GitLab CI.

Experience implementing Docker, Kubernetes, KVM, Talos, NixOS, or Openstack environments.

Experience with artifact repository management.

Administrative level proficiency with Linux OS.

Nice-to-have Skills

Experience with ticketing system integration, such as Github Actions and Jira.

Experience with pip, npm, composer, or other packaging systems.

Demonstrated expertise with multiple programming and scripting languages including Python, C, C++, and bash.

Experience with Ansible, Terraform, Puppet, Nix, or Chef for repeatable build environment spin-ups.

Technology Tags

Neutral Atoms

The job description explicitly states the company works on 'neutral atom quantum computers,' defining the core hardware technology context for this role.

IT infrastructure

The role involves designing and maintaining scalable architectures for software builds and distribution, which is a core IT infrastructure function.

Classical programming

The role requires proficiency in common programming and scripting languages like Python, C, C++, and bash for developing and maintaining build systems.

Control software

The engineer is responsible for building and maintaining software systems that facilitate the control of QuEra's quantum computing hardware.

Control algorithms

The role involves collaboration on calibration workflows and experimental software, implying interaction with the underlying control algorithms for quantum operations.

Quantum compilers

The job description explicitly mentions collaboration with 'compilers' as part of the software ecosystem for quantum operations.

Cloud platforms

The role requires experience with containerization and virtualization technologies like Docker and Kubernetes, which are essential for cloud-native development and deployment.